As Chief Investment Officer of 5th generation Max-Berlinicke-Erben single family office, I run a multi-asset portfolio with a total portfolio approach mindset, and a particular focus on asset allocation and manager selection. This means each asset class, sub asset class, all the way down to individual assets, need to compete to earn a place in the overall portfolio 💼. I access the multi-asset opportunities through specialized managers globally. Via piggyback-/co-investments, I also enter some of the highest conviction positions of my managers directly. Apart from achieving positive real returns, the metric that matters the most is the marginal impact on risk adjusted return. Each change alters the expected risk adjusted returns and the overall portfolio exposure to core drivers like growth, inflation, credit, real rates, momentum, quality, value, etc. I am constantly looking for differentiated strategies run by preferably boutique managers that improve the expected risk adjusted return over a 10 year horizon. ⚓️ A word on the Big Debate: I prefer the liquidity of publicly listed assets to the smoothed volatility of private markets. I’d rather have drawdowns along the way but be able to course-correct an investment than rely on continuation vehicles fraught with conflicts of interest or evergreen vehicles where liquidity proves elusive. ⚓️ My investment vehicles of choice: Funds (institutional share classes only) and listed investment trusts/permanent capital vehicles (capitalising on at times very wide discounts to NAV) rather than segregated mandates or LPs. ⚓️ My mottos „Better vaguely right than precisely wrong“ and „Skate to where the puck is going, not where it has been“ have to a growing extent guided me as an investor over the 35+ years I have been active in global markets — and they continue to serve me well. ℹ️ For counterparties — Please submit info packages for new investment proposals to: 📬 [email protected]

Asset Value Investors (AVI) is a London based FCA authorised investment management firm founded in 1985. The firm manages over £1.8bn across a range of listed funds, open-ended funds, and mandates. AVI specialises in investing in securities that for several reasons may be selling on anomalous valuations. The core focus is on buying high quality, growing businesses trading at wide discounts to their net asset value (NAV). This strategy involves conducting detailed fundamental research in order to understand the drivers of NAV growth and assess the catalysts for a narrowing discount. AVI targets situations where it sees a clear valuation anomaly and often uses engagement or activism to help unlock value and narrow discounts.
